
Alison Cotton is a British viola player based in London working in composition and improvisation. As well as her solo work, she is one half of the Walthamstow-based songwriting partnership, The Left Outsides. She has been a member of Saloon, The Eighteenth Day Of May, Trimdon Grange Explosion, ...
